Abstract :
An empirical formula for the resonant frequency of bow-tie microstrip antennas is presented, which is based on the cavity model of microstrip patch antennas. A procedure to design a bow-tie antenna using a genetic algorithm (GA) in which we take the formula as a fitness function is also given. An optimized bow-tie antenna using the genetic algorithm was measured. Numerical and experimental results are used to validate the formula and GA. The results are in good agreement.
